IP-Based Interoperability

Improved ease of use and management for comprehensive communications interoperability

– Personnel in the same or different agencies can communicate across previously isolated radio, IP, and non-IP networks

Improved Response, Flexibility, and Reach– Delivers information to any type of communications

device: radio, telephone, IP phone, cell phone, or PC client

Policy-based application capabilities• Integrated policy-based communications, incident

management, notification, alerting, communications interoperability

Investment protection, reduced costs, enabling new applications and technologies

Closing Comments IP-Based Emergency Communications

– Are available today and being used to enhance existing communications systems

– Can be implemented in scalable, secure, and mobile forms– Can transparently integrated wired and wireless technologies– Provide options for rapid response for deployment or restoration

Emergency communications sector is rapidly moving toward IP Recommendations for your report

– Hospitals and public health organizations should begin migrating their emergency communications networks and capabilities to IP

– Immediate Congressional support advanced technologies for emergency health communications

– Fund a series of pilot projects that implement advanced technologies in emergency services

– Experience is critical to identify “best practices” and governance issues that will confront you with an array of new capabilities

– Document and make publicly available reports on pilots to provide invaluable learning tool for others who are seeking to improve their emergency communications capabilities
